From cfad9102eb45541eb9b3308ae75f3f6a024381e0 Mon Sep 17 00:00:00 2001 From: jsancho Date: Tue, 31 Aug 2010 09:19:11 +0000 Subject: [PATCH] --- Makefile | 2 +- gacela_SDL.lisp | 4 ++++ 2 files changed, 5 insertions(+), 1 deletion(-) diff --git a/Makefile b/Makefile index f38a6d7..72e5898 100644 --- a/Makefile +++ b/Makefile @@ -1,7 +1,7 @@ LISP = gcl INC = -I/usr/include/FTGL -I/usr/include/freetype2 # LIBS = -lSDL -lSDL_image -lSDL_ttf -lSDL_mixer -lSDL_gfx -lGL -lGLU -lftgl -LIBS = -lSDL -lSDL_image -lSDL_mixer -lGL -lGLU -lftgl +LIBS = -lSDL -lSDL_image -lSDL_mixer -lSDL_gfx -lGL -lGLU -lftgl OBJ = gacela.o gacela_misc.o gacela_SDL.o gacela_GL.o gacela_FTGL.o \ gacela_draw.o gacela_ttf.o gacela_events.o gacela_mobs.o \ diff --git a/gacela_SDL.lisp b/gacela_SDL.lisp index 47a8a27..eff4f1a 100644 --- a/gacela_SDL.lisp +++ b/gacela_SDL.lisp @@ -144,6 +144,9 @@ (defcfun "int gacela_SDL_ByteOrder (void)" 0 "return SDL_BYTEORDER;") +(defcfun "int gacela_zoomSurface (int src, double zoomx, double zoomy, int smooth)" 0 + "return zoomSurface (src, zoomx, zoomy, smooth);") + (defentry SDL_Init (int) (int "gacela_SDL_Init")) (defentry SDL_Quit () (void "gacela_SDL_Quit")) (defentry SDL_SetVideoMode (int int int int) (int "gacela_SDL_SetVideoMode")) @@ -184,6 +187,7 @@ (defentry SDL_GL_SwapBuffers () (void "gacela_SDL_GL_SwapBuffers")) (defentry SDL_EnableKeyRepeat (int int) (int "gacela_SDL_EnableKeyRepeat")) (defentry SDL_ByteOrder () (int "gacela_SDL_ByteOrder")) +(defentry zoomSurface (int double double int) (int "gacela_zoomSurface")) ;;; C-Gacela Functions (defcfun "int gacela_surface_format (int surface)" 0 -- 2.39.5